Does male pattern baldness start on one side?
Because one-sided hair thinning is less common, the cause can be puzzling. Sometimes, hair loss can occur more quickly on one side of your head if you have male or female pattern hair loss, but hair loss will happen on both sides of your head.
Why am I balding on the sides of my head?
There are a number of conditions and behaviors that can result in hair loss on your temples. Androgenetic alopecia is one of the most common causes of hair loss. For men, it is known as male-pattern baldness. This type of hair loss is genetic, and hair loss above the temples is often the first sign.

How does male pattern baldness affect the body?
Each hair on your head has a growth cycle. With male pattern baldness, this growth cycle begins to weaken and the hair follicle shrinks, producing shorter and finer strands of hair. Eventually, the growth cycle for each hair ends and no new hair grows in its place. Inherited male pattern baldness usually has no side effects.
